The three in contention would be Arko, Valobra stick, and Palmolive, though I don't use any of them as sticks. They're all milled into bowls. Palmolive is the scent that gets me highest of the three. Valobra has great lather, and the scent reminds my wife of lye soap her grandmothers made, which is a plus in its category. Arko's lather is as good as Valobra's, or nearly, and I like its price and scent better than Valobra. So, I guess Arko, but I would likely weep into my pillow for Valobra and Palmolive.
